B-(3,5-Dichloro-4-propoxyphenyl)boronic acid

Description:
B-(3,5-Dichloro-4-propoxyphenyl)boronic acid is an organoboron compound characterized by the presence of a boronic acid functional group attached to a phenyl ring that is further substituted with chlorine and propoxy groups. The compound features a boron atom bonded to a hydroxyl group and an aryl group, which is typical for boronic acids, allowing it to participate in various chemical reactions, particularly in Suzuki coupling reactions, which are essential in organic synthesis for forming carbon-carbon bonds. The dichloro substituents on the phenyl ring enhance its reactivity and may influence its solubility and stability in different solvents. Additionally, the propoxy group contributes to the compound's hydrophobic characteristics, potentially affecting its interaction with biological systems and its application in medicinal chemistry. Overall, this compound is of interest in the fields of organic synthesis and materials science due to its unique structural features and reactivity profile.
Formula:C9H11BCl2O3
InChI:InChI=1S/C9H11BCl2O3/c1-2-3-15-9-7(11)4-6(10(13)14)5-8(9)12/h4-5,13-14H,2-3H2,1H3
InChI key:InChIKey=GXOBEFMWCPTAAN-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:O(CCC)C1=C(Cl)C=C(B(O)O)C=C1Cl
